package org.apache.qpid.server;
import org.apache.qpid.test.utils.QpidTestCase;
import java.util.Arrays;
import java.util.Collections;
import java.util.HashSet;
import java.util.Set;
public class BrokerOptionsTest extends QpidTestCase
{
private BrokerOptions _options;
private static final int TEST_PORT1 = 6789;
private static final int TEST_PORT2 = 6790;
protected void setUp()
{
_options = new BrokerOptions();
}
public void testDefaultPort()
{
assertEquals(Collections.<Integer>emptySet(), _options.getPorts());
}
public void testOverriddenPort()
{
_options.addPort(TEST_PORT1);
assertEquals(Collections.singleton(TEST_PORT1), _options.getPorts());
}
public void testManyOverriddenPorts()
{
_options.addPort(TEST_PORT1);
_options.addPort(TEST_PORT2);
final Set<Integer> expectedPorts = new HashSet<Integer>(Arrays.asList(new Integer[] {TEST_PORT1, TEST_PORT2}));
assertEquals(expectedPorts, _options.getPorts());
}
public void testDuplicateOverriddenPortsAreSilentlyIgnored()
{
_options.addPort(TEST_PORT1);
_options.addPort(TEST_PORT2);
_options.addPort(TEST_PORT1); // duplicate - should be silently ignored
final Set<Integer> expectedPorts = new HashSet<Integer>(Arrays.asList(new Integer[] {TEST_PORT1, TEST_PORT2}));
assertEquals(expectedPorts, _options.getPorts());
}
public void testDefaultSSLPort()
{
assertEquals(Collections.<Integer>emptySet(), _options.getSSLPorts());
}
public void testOverriddenSSLPort()
{
_options.addSSLPort(TEST_PORT1);
assertEquals(Collections.singleton(TEST_PORT1), _options.getSSLPorts());
}
public void testManyOverriddenSSLPorts()
{
_options.addSSLPort(TEST_PORT1);
_options.addSSLPort(TEST_PORT2);
final Set<Integer> expectedPorts = new HashSet<Integer>(Arrays.asList(new Integer[] {TEST_PORT1, TEST_PORT2}));
assertEquals(expectedPorts, _options.getSSLPorts());
}
public void testDuplicateOverriddenSSLPortsAreSilentlyIgnored()
{
_options.addSSLPort(TEST_PORT1);
_options.addSSLPort(TEST_PORT2);
_options.addSSLPort(TEST_PORT1); // duplicate - should be silently ignored
final Set<Integer> expectedPorts = new HashSet<Integer>(Arrays.asList(new Integer[] {TEST_PORT1, TEST_PORT2}));
assertEquals(expectedPorts, _options.getSSLPorts());
}
public void testDefaultConfigFile()
{
assertNull(_options.getConfigFile());
}
public void testOverriddenConfigFile()
{
final String testConfigFile = "etc/mytestconfig.xml";
_options.setConfigFile(testConfigFile);
assertEquals(testConfigFile, _options.getConfigFile());
}
public void testDefaultLogConfigFile()
{
assertNull(_options.getLogConfigFile());
}
public void testOverriddenLogConfigFile()
{
final String testLogConfigFile = "etc/mytestlog4j.xml";
_options.setLogConfigFile(testLogConfigFile);
assertEquals(testLogConfigFile, _options.getLogConfigFile());
}
public void testDefaultJmxPortRegistryServer()
{
assertNull(_options.getJmxPortRegistryServer());
}
public void testJmxPortRegistryServer()
{
_options.setJmxPortRegistryServer(TEST_PORT1);
assertEquals(Integer.valueOf(TEST_PORT1), _options.getJmxPortRegistryServer());
}
public void testDefaultJmxPortConnectorServer()
{
assertNull(_options.getJmxPortConnectorServer());
}
public void testJmxPortConnectorServer()
{
_options.setJmxPortConnectorServer(TEST_PORT1);
assertEquals(Integer.valueOf(TEST_PORT1), _options.getJmxPortConnectorServer());
}
public void testQpidHomeExposesSysProperty()
{
assertEquals(System.getProperty("QPID_HOME"), _options.getQpidHome());
}
public void testDefaultExcludesPortFor0_10()
{
assertEquals(Collections.EMPTY_SET, _options.getExcludedPorts(ProtocolExclusion.v0_10));
}
public void testOverriddenExcludesPortFor0_10()
{
_options.addExcludedPort(ProtocolExclusion.v0_10, TEST_PORT1);
assertEquals(Collections.singleton(TEST_PORT1), _options.getExcludedPorts(ProtocolExclusion.v0_10));
}
public void testManyOverriddenExcludedPortFor0_10()
{
_options.addExcludedPort(ProtocolExclusion.v0_10, TEST_PORT1);
_options.addExcludedPort(ProtocolExclusion.v0_10, TEST_PORT2);
final Set<Integer> expectedPorts = new HashSet<Integer>(Arrays.asList(new Integer[] {TEST_PORT1, TEST_PORT2}));
assertEquals(expectedPorts, _options.getExcludedPorts(ProtocolExclusion.v0_10));
}
public void testDuplicatedOverriddenExcludedPortFor0_10AreSilentlyIgnored()
{
_options.addExcludedPort(ProtocolExclusion.v0_10, TEST_PORT1);
_options.addExcludedPort(ProtocolExclusion.v0_10, TEST_PORT2);
final Set<Integer> expectedPorts = new HashSet<Integer>(Arrays.asList(new Integer[] {TEST_PORT1, TEST_PORT2}));
assertEquals(expectedPorts, _options.getExcludedPorts(ProtocolExclusion.v0_10));
}
public void testDefaultBind()
{
assertNull(_options.getBind());
}
public void testOverriddenBind()
{
final String bind = "192.168.0.1";
_options.setBind(bind);
assertEquals(bind, _options.getBind());
}
public void testDefaultLogWatchFrequency()
{
assertEquals(0L, _options.getLogWatchFrequency());
}
public void testOverridenLogWatchFrequency()
{
final int myFreq = 10 * 1000;
_options.setLogWatchFrequency(myFreq);
assertEquals(myFreq, _options.getLogWatchFrequency());
}
}
